| After yearly trips to Manhattan for more than two decades, we decided it was time to cross the bridge. Rick provided us with an authentic view of his lifelong neighborhood. From history to culture to architecture we were immersed in a fun and informative walk. The legendary brownstones are lovely, the churches and former mansions magnificent. We learned of Revolutionary battles, Olmsted's "other" park, the ethnic diversity through the years, urban gardens and more all sprinkled with anecdotes only this real Brooklynite could provide. Rick customized our tour to our interests and left us wanting to return. And don't forget the pizza! |
